Last week, My p38 hard faulted eas to bumpstops
I knew it leaked down overnite in cold weather for approx 2mos (I'm slightly passive-resistant).
I bought (12) 1/4 x 7/16 o-rings @ hardware - $5 or so
I spent 1hr installing (A-d-d) said o-rings & spray soaping for leaks.
I spent 2hrs jumpering,unplugging,bypassing to conclude that I may end up bastardizing my truck to make it driveable.
(instant gratification)
BUT, I found online EAS unlock software "beta" free. (divine intervention) BONUS
All-in-All I spent approx 15mins in my truck READING-CLEARING-UNLOCKING the dreaded EAS computer.
In another 5mins he-she-it had filled the tank & risen to height.
In 3 days I've started it at least a dozen times, driven well over a hundred miles & I believe it's only slightly pumped up twice after being parked.
& that was less than 5 seconds each.

g409 -- Congrats - that is awesome. How do you interface the software to your rover? notebook / cable? / other way?
I wonder if 93 EAS is similar enough to 96 ....
My EAS did the same to me after storage and I tried to start it on a 0 volt, stone dead battery. Several other times it recovered just fine after a long sleep BUT I had disconnected the battery completely. the 0volt click-click-cllllliiiicccccK kicked it into safe mode. I jump it with the pigtail socket 1/8/11/27/28/etc.... method but I really want to restore the functioning system. It is a great option.

I slapped together a desktop from a bunch of parts (honest), put it on 2x4's on my pass seat in the garage & ran ext cord.
I made up comm cable from serial (com1) to obtII
after unzipping files, you have (3) programs: read faults - recal ride heights - unlock EAS ECU
They're menu driven - easy
I'd like to say that I read about doing rover classic w/obdI, but I wasn't paying too much att as mine's a p38
type "eas reset" into your browser or "sourceforge" or "argusvisual.com"
The common thread is a person AKA "malafax_dand"
He (&friends) spent last year on this.
He's a rover owner
